ECharts图表库下载指南-资源获取与安装教程全解析
19429202025-03-30下载地址24 浏览
作为一款由百度开源并捐赠给Apache基金会的数据可视化工具,ECharts凭借其强大的图表渲染能力和灵活的定制特性,已成为全球开发者构建交互式数据看板的首选方案之一。本文将从实际应用角度解析该工具的获取路径与使用技巧,并探讨其生态发展的可能性。
一、核心特性与行业定位

ECharts的核心竞争力体现在三个维度:
1. 全场景图表支持:覆盖30余种基础图表类型,包括热力图、关系图、3D地理图等复杂形态,支持多坐标系混搭与动态数据更新。
2. 跨平台兼容性:兼容IE8+及主流浏览器,提供Canvas与SVG双渲染引擎,可承载千万级数据量的实时交互。
3. 开源生态优势:作为Apache孵化项目,拥有超过300位贡献者维护代码库,企业级用户包括阿里巴巴、腾讯等头部科技公司。
二、资源获取与安装部署

方式一:官方渠道下载
1. 访问[Apache ECharts官网],点击导航栏"Download"进入下载页
2. 选择完整版(echarts.js)、常用版(mon.js)或精简版(echarts.simple.js),推荐初次使用者下载5.6版本的完整发行包
3. 解压后的目录结构包含示例代码、主题文件及核心JS库,建议将`dist/echarts.min.js`文件置于项目静态资源目录
方式二:CDN动态加载
国内开发者推荐使用Staticfile CDN加速服务,在HTML文件中插入:
html
2. 初始化图表实例
javascript
const chart = echarts.init(document.getElementById('chart-container'));
3. 配置数据选项
javascript
const option = {
title: { text: '商品销量分析' },
tooltip: { trigger: 'axis' },
xAxis: { data: ['手机','电脑','平板','耳机'] },
yAxis: {},
series: [{
type: 'bar',
data: [1200, 850, 600, 300]
}]
};
4. 渲染图表
javascript
chart.setOption(option);
完整案例可在官方示例库中获取,支持在线编辑调试。
四、安全机制与风险防范
作为Apache基金会管理项目,其安全策略包括:
1. 代码审计:每季度进行第三方安全扫描,漏洞修复响应时间不超过72小时
2. 传输加密:官方推荐通过HTTPS加载资源,防止中间人攻击
3. 漏洞披露:,执行保密披露流程直至补丁发布
五、用户反馈与发展趋势
根据开发者社区调研显示,78%的用户认为其学习曲线平缓,但高级定制功能需要掌握配置项手册。医疗器械企业"康维科技"的案例显示,通过ECharts构建的疫情数据监测系统,将报表生成效率提升40%。
未来版本规划显示三个重点方向:
1. 3D可视化增强:集成WebGL引擎支持大规模三维场景渲染
2. 智能化配置:引入AI辅助的图表类型推荐系统
3. 移动端优化:开发手势交互组件提升触屏设备体验
通过本文的系统性解读可见,ECharts不仅降低了数据可视化的技术门槛,其开放架构更为企业级应用提供了可靠基础。无论是初创团队快速搭建数据看板,还是金融机构处理高频交易数据,都能在该生态中找到适配解决方案。随着5.6版本对实时流数据的支持强化,这款工具正在重新定义数据叙事的方式。